- [ ] Before we rotate the signing keys for Pixelbarn, double-check the image cache fix actually shipped. The old thumbnail cache in Snapcrate leaked memory like a sieve — support kept getting "app frozen" tickets every Friday. If the heap graph in the dashboard still climbs past 2 GB, abort the ceremony and ping the Lumera platform crew. Once confirmed stable, unseal the backup envelope and read out the phrase below to the witness.

unlock words, yawig-kagef: gordor-holvan-ulaael-pramir-ulaiel-tamdor

The job runs nightly, comparing warehouse counts against the Tallyhouse ledger and posting adjustments. Under normal operation, no manual intervention is required. If the job halts mid-run and leaves adjustment locks in place, downstream fulfillment at the Ashbrook depot will stall by morning. In that case, the on-call engineer may open the reconciliation console in override mode to release the locks. Override mode requires the recovery passphrase, which is printed below.

recovery phrase for bawep-kawef: oliath-casdor

Following the flood event at the Marrowgate branch, the insurer has proposed a 12% premium increase alongside tightened excess terms for property damage. We have negotiated improved liability limits and retained full business-interruption cover. Branch managers should verify local asset valuations before the deadline and flag discrepancies promptly. The wider commercial considerations informing our negotiating position are set out in the confidential note below.

management briefing: Silethax Systems plans to raise the Holix list price by 50.2 percent in December. The steering committee signed off on a budget of $329.9 million for Project Holok. The renewal with Juldorax Foods closes at $278.2 million a year, 54.3 percent above the last contract. Project Briir slips by one quarter because of the supplier delay.

Subject: New point of contact for SquatGuard

Hi plugin folks,

Small heads-up: the team behind SquatGuard, our typo-squatting package scanner, is reshuffling a bit. Day-to-day triage of false positives, allowlist requests, and the scanner ruleset is moving off my plate as I head over to the Larkspur project. Nothing changes in how you submit reports — same workflow, same turnaround promise. If anything feels slower in the next two weeks, be patient with us. Going forward, the person responsible for all SquatGuard matters is listed below.

signatory, yagap-bawig: Ulaath Eliath